<p> <b><i>-ing</i></b> is a <a href="page.php?w=suffix">suffix</a> used to make one of the <a href="page.php?w=inflection">inflected</a> forms of <a href="page.php?w=English_verbs">English verbs</a>. This verb form is used as a <a href="page.php?w=present_participle">present participle</a>, as a <a href="page.php?w=gerund">gerund</a>, and sometimes as an independent <a href="page.php?w=noun">noun</a> or <a href="page.php?w=adjective">adjective</a>. The suffix is also found in certain words like morning and ceiling, and in names such as Browning.</p><p>
